About the Keras test

Keras is one of the most powerful machine learning modules in Python. Most AI applications are dependent on high-level neural networks, and it can sometimes be hard to write such algorithms from scratch; that’s where Keras comes in. Keras is a high-level API that can be configured to run in very few lines of code. Keras is now fully integrated with TensorFlow and is used widely in most deep learning projects. Keras is a deep-learning API used to implement neural networks. This easy-to-use, free, and open-source Python library helps developers define deep-learning models faster.
